Mahenge Liandu Resource Upgrade to 51.1Mt at 9.3% TGC
With 75% now in the Indicated Category
Armadale, the AIM quoted investment company focused on natural resource projects in Africa, is pleased to announce a Resource upgrade at the Mahenge Liandu Graphite Project in Tanzania (�Mahenge Liandu�).
Overview
Infill drilling of the resource at Mahenge Liandu undertaken to upgrade the category from Inferred to Indicated to allow for feasibility studies, mine planning and economics
Resource successfully upgraded to 51.1Mt at 9.3% Total Graphitic Carbon (�TGC�), including 38.7Mt Indicted at 9.3% and 12.4Mt at 9.1% TGC
Upgrade represents a 25% increase from the previous 40.9Mt inferred resource at 9.41% TGC
Over 75% of the Resource now in the Indicated category
TGC grade and quantum of indicated resource confirms Mahenge Liandu as one of the highest-grade graphite deposits in Tanzania and the rest of the world
Areas of high-grade, near surface mineralisation have been confirmed, allowing a staged approach to development, which lowers the capital development and operating costs early in the mine life
Test work completed to date has confirmed that premium quality, high purity concentrates can be produced using a conventional flotation circuit
A diamond drilling programme is planned to commence at the conclusion of the wet season (March / April 2018) to provide samples for more extensive metallurgical test work
The deposit remains open to the north south and down dip, meaning there is significant potential to increase the resource further, with further drilling planned for later in 2018
Mine planning has now commenced and the results from this and the updated resource will be incorporated in the Scoping Study being carried out by experienced engineering consultancy BatteryLimits, which is currently underway � results of the Scoping Study are expected by the end of Q1 2018
Combination of a number of key factors � high overall TGC grade, sizable indicated resource, ability to utilise convention flotation circuit to produce premium quality product and near surface mineralisation with super high grade TGC (see below) � all point to the ability to produce an extremely robust initial scoping study which will provide first pass project economics
